There are a variety of types of leather that can be used for upholstery on a chesterfield sofa, and each one has distinct characteristics. The characteristic of a leather that is pigmented is smooth surface texture, a durable finish and a polymer-based coating that contains pigments. This kind of leather is available in a variety of styles such as plain, embossed, and printed.
The tanning process gives aniline leather an incredibly natural, soft appearance. It is a popular material for furniture because it's flexible and can be stretched into a variety of shapes without compromising structural strength. Aniline leather is prone to wear and tear since it is not protected by a layer.
Semi-aniline leather is a compromise that provides a more improved durability than a leather with a pigmented coating, but still retains much of the natural appearance of aniline leather. It has a low-pigment surface coating that can be lightly embossed to add texture and visual interest to the piece, but it isn't able to stretch as much as aniline leather.

When looking for a chesterfield, search for quality materials that will endure the rigors of daily use.
A chesterfield made of premium leather has a natural appearance that can last a lifetime if it is properly maintained. To ensure the longevity of your sofa, choose one that is constructed using genuine full hide. Avoid imitation leather as it isn't easy to clean and more prone to stains. If you're buying a chesterfield sofa pre-made be sure to choose one with a sturdy frame made from beechwood that has been seasoned and with strong rails that can withstand the weight of a huge sofa.
When choosing a chesterfield, ensure it comes with plenty of cushion padding to provide you with a an incredibly comfortable and relaxing sitting experience. Foam is a popular choice, but feathers and polyester fibres can be used in combination to create hybrid cushioning. You should also check that the filling is secured to the frame by hand, so it doesn't change shape or shrink over time.
Another key feature of a quality chesterfield is the suspension system. The cheaper sofas typically use a less robust spring or webbing that is more prone to break over time. However, a chesterfield made well should have webbing that's secured with screw-fixed corner blocks and is able to provide plenty of springing action.

A high-quality Chesterfield leather corner sofa will last for a long time. It should be simple to tell the difference between a genuine Chesterfield and a replica that isn't able to endure the test of time. A frame constructed of high-quality materials is the first thing to look for. The cheaper materials such as particleboard and MDF are not sufficient to withstand the weight of a Chesterfield frame, which means that the frame will begin to bend under pressure.
Another important indicator of a true Chesterfield is the depth and quality of the cushion filling. The frame should be concealed under the cushioning and if you choose to use foam, it must be dense, high-quality material. A high-quality Chesterfield will use various densities to create a hybrid cushioning system that is both soft and bolstering.
The suspension system on a Chesterfield must also be of high quality. The cheaper models will have spring units that are coiled, or lower-quality webbing, which are susceptible to breaking under stress. A high-quality suspension will consist of made up of sprung and webbing components, which provide a great combination of comfort and durability.
The quality of the Chesterfield's details is also important. The cheaper pieces will not have the details completely, whereas high-end pieces will be careful to properly apply the deep-buttoning that gives the sofa its distinctive design and holds it together. Also, the studs on a quality Chesterfield will be hammered individually into place, whereas mass-produced couches will have buttons sunk into the cushions and glued to the frame.

A chesterfield corner sofa is an elegant feature for any home decor. To keep the look of the leather, it is important to maintain it. Regular dusting and occasional cleaning will prolong the life of the sofa. Regular inspection will also allow you to spot problems and address them before they become worse.
Leather is very sensitive to moisture, and it is crucial to keep it hydrated and moisturised by using a quality leather conditioner or protectant. This will prevent cracking and sagging. It is also a good idea to keep the sofa out of direct sunlight and away from sources of heat. Light and heat can cause leather to dry out and cause the leather to crack and stiffen.
Spills, Spots, and Stains
Accidental spillages on a sofa made of leather can cause serious damage, especially if they are not cleaned immediately. Use a dry cloth as soon as you can to clean up any liquid spills. This will prevent the leather from getting stained by the water or other chemicals. Ink spills can be extremely damaging and should always be dealt with promptly. Using a protection cream on your leather will help protect it from such staining. It will also block general water and oil-based stains making them easier to clean.
Regularly vacuum your leather sofa using a soft brush attachment. This will remove dust, dirt and other debris that can dull the look of your Chesterfield. It will also eliminate any loose fibres that might be accumulating in the corners and crevices of your sofa. This is an easy way to keep the Chesterfield looking brand new.
You can apply a leather cream or spray to your sofa to protect it from stains and marks. This is particularly beneficial for aniline, semianiline and pigmented hides. It will provide an additional layer of protection and prevent your leather from being damaged by spills or other stains.
Keep pets away from furniture made of leather to avoid them scratching and chewing the delicate material. Keep sharp objects away from leather furniture to protect it.
